Output 867f93a1d9a7403d1e3f43cdf9fb2426ea7ffe7ddeb2fc159e21d517a857d241:11

value
1576642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 632c6789b87c33a9112ca9fe98740d2f2c502310 OP_EQUAL
address
3AjQ1ovn7JjJxnimYnbJwxtG1UogVAMWv5
transaction
867f93a1d9a7403d1e3f43cdf9fb2426ea7ffe7ddeb2fc159e21d517a857d241
spent
true